Three people were arrested in Long Beach Tuesday after police said they were involved in a dramatic armed bank robbery in Newport Beach less than an hour earlier. About 11 a.m., two men walked into the Bank of America, 3300 E. Coast Hwy., in Corona del Mar, wearing dark clothes, dark sunglasses, fake beards and brandishing handguns. The men ordered employees and bank customers to lie on the ground while they hopped the teller counter and took cash before fleeing, police said.

BELMONT SHORE - Corona del Mar High girls swim coach Doug Volding was all smiles Thursday following his team's standout showing at the CIF Relays Preliminaries at Belmont Plaza. All seven of his teams qualified for Saturday's finals, with three teams earning berths in the championship bracket. Brittney Bowlus led off the 6 x 50 free with a CIF-qualifying time of 25.72 as CdM logged a fourth-place effort of 2:34.98. With Bowlus were Kim McKay, Christina Hewko, Jackie McCoy, Vivian Liao and Lauren Powers.

BELMONT SHORE - Newport-Mesa District boys and girls swimmers will be among those competing for berths in the CIF Southern Section Division Finals, when preliminaries begin today at Belmont Plaza Olympic Pool. Division I hopefuls, including Newport Harbor High boys standout Aaron Peirsol and top Sailor girls, Nicole Mackey and Carly Geehr, will begin pursuit of one of eight berths in the championship finals, when prelims begin at 10 a.m. The Division II prelims, including swimmers from Corona del Mar and Costa Mesa, start at 4:30 p.m. In addition to eight spots in the championship finals, eight swimmers, and/or relay teams, will qualify for a consolation final in each division.

Tony Altobelli BELMONT SHORE - Corona del Mar High boys swimming standout Sherwin Kim went up against the best of the best at Saturday's CIF Southern Section Division II finals. The junior, who was the Sea Kings' only individual finalist on the boys side, posted a personal-best time in the 100-yard freestyle finals and placed eighth with a 48.59. Kim posted a 2:00.64 in the 200 individual medley finals, but was disqualified during the butterfly portion for separating his feet, according to CdM Coach Tim Chaix.

BELMONT SHORE - Corona del Mar High freshman Jordan Anae broke her own school record in the 100-yard backstroke, not once, but twice at the CIF Southern Section Division II Swim Preliminaries at Belmont Plaza Thursday. Anae (100 freestyle and 100 back), sophomore Kim McKay (200 and 500 free) and junior Brittany Bowlus (50 free) qualified for Saturday's championship finals. McKay, Bowlus and Anae, along with sophomore Vivian Liao also qualified in the 200 and 400 free relays.
